In order to solve the "agonizing question",Marx made a critical analysis of Hegel’s philosophy of right,and his first work was " the Critique of Hegel’s philosophy of right"(hereinafter referred to as "the critique manuscript").By criticizing Hegel’s philosophy of right which was "in the forefront of The Times",Marx indirectly criticized the capitalist society and took an important step towards historical materialism.The stormy bourgeois political revolution changed the world and separated civil society from the political state.How do we understand the relationship? What method should be adopted to achieve the reunification of the two parts?How to understand the relationship between political state and civil society.With the principle of subject-predicate inversion,Marx reversed the relationship between civil society and political state reversed by Hegel,thinking that "civil society determines political state".Through the analysis of the primogeniture system,Marx thought that private property determines the legislative power and political state.From then on,Marx opened a new perspective of studying history--civil society.On the one hand,the bourgeois political state promises equal political power to the people.On the other hand,the civil society is divided into different classes,people fight for their own interests.So,people are alienated into " member of a political state" and " members of the civil society".The divided "citizens" impose their human essence on the "political state",which is the religious field of people’s life and cannot realize the universal essence of people.During the period of " the Germany-France Yearbook",Marx put forward the goal of human liberation.How to realize the reunification of civil society and political country.Hegel advocates a constitutional monarchy,but there are insuperable flaws in his design of state institutions: mystique,conservatism and contempt for the people.He described rather than actually resolved the separation between civil society and the political state.Although Marx’s "True Democracy" is a kind of political society,but it realizes the unification of civil society and political state and realizes the freedom of people.It is the "bridge" to communism.Marx believed that it is the people that should establish a new state system by means of revolution.The state system should safeguard the interests of the people and it is only the people that can evaluate the "good or bad" of a state system.Without a scientific view of practice,Marx’s concept of "people" is an abstract concept.However,on the issue of "the nature of man",Marx turned his eyes to "the real experienced man" itself,highlighting the "social characteristics" of man,and regarded labor as "the universal nature of man".Marx inherited Hegel’s thinking frame of separating civil society from political state,and analyzed problems with distinct Feuerbach humanism background.In this manuscript,idealism and materialism,revolutionary democracy and communism interweave each other.So this manuscript is not a mature historical materialism book,walking on the way to the historical materialism.
